Door refacing services involve replacing or updating the exterior surface of a door without removing the entire door frame. This process typically includes applying a new veneer, overlay, or finish to the existing door to improve its appearance and functionality. It’s a practical way to give an entryway a fresh, modern look or to restore a door that has become worn or outdated, all while avoiding the cost and effort of a full replacement.
This service is especially helpful for addressing common problems such as visible damage, scratches, dents, or peeling finishes that can detract from a home's curb appeal. It also offers a solution for doors that are structurally sound but look tired or aged. Door refacing can help enhance security by providing a more solid, updated surface and improve insulation, contributing to better energy efficiency in the home.

The overview below groups typical Door Refacing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- For minor door refacing projects,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, covering simple cosmetic updates or minor surface fixes.
Moderate Projects - Mid-sized refacing jobs, such as replacing panels or updating hardware, generally cost between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common and often involve more detailed work or multiple doors.
Large-Scale Refacing - Larger or more complex door refacing projects can range from $1,500 to $3,000. Fewer projects reach this tier, usually involving custom finishes or extensive surface preparation.
Full Replacement or Custom Work - For complete door replacements or highly customized refacing, costs can exceed $3,000 and reach $5,000 or more. These are typically reserved for high-end materials or intricate designs, and are less common than mid-range projects.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
